Is it possible to create an exclusions list?


  • New Participant
  • 3 replies

Hi,

 

We sent an email to 1300 users to sign up for a webinar. the places filled quickly (100) so we're running another. Is there a way to message the same group *excluding* the people who attended the 1st webinar?

 

I've found 2 options on how to proceed but can't see how this could work in Intercom.

 

Option 1 : the Intercom/Zoom integration. But that simply inserts a link to the webinar into the message right? It doesn't actually record who has registered?

 

Option 2: I've exported a CSV list of attendees but again, I don't see how to use this as an exclusion list in Intercom.

 

Any ideas?

Hi @brad h​ , Welcome to Interconnect 👋

 

You should use the tagging features, tag users with - Webinar1; Webinar2 and etc.

During Sending you can exclude people by tag.

 

Hope this is what you are looking for.

@brad h​ , You can use Spreadsheet data to update users in Intercom (Bulk data update via CSV upload).

 

You can upload CSV and tag users who watched Webinar 1.

@brad h​ have you looked into using Zapier to link Intercom and Zoom? You can create a Zap so that every time there is a new registrant for one of your webinars, it automatically tags the corresponding user in Intercom 👍
